Garlic Butter Mushroom and Mozzarella Calzone
Created by: Howcan Team
Ingredients
- 1 pound pizza dough
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 8 ounces mushrooms, sliced
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1/2 teaspoon dried basil
- 1 1/2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C).
- In a large skillet, melt 1 tablespoon of but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.
- Add the sliced mushrooms to the skillet and sauté for 5-7 minutes until they release their moisture and become golden brown. Season with salt, pepper, oregano, and basil. Remove from heat and set aside.
- Divide the pizza dough into 4 equal portions. Roll each portion into a 8-inch circle on a lightly floured surface.
- In a small saucepan, melt the remaining 1 tablespoon of butter. Brush the edges of each dough circle with the melted garlic butter.
- Divide the sautéed mushrooms evenly among the dough circles, leaving a 1-inch border around the edges. Sprinkle the m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the mushrooms.
- Fold the dough over the filling to create a half-moon shape. Press the edges firmly to seal and crimp with a fork.
- Transfer the calzones to a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Brush the tops with any remaining garlic butter.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the calzones are golden brown and crispy.
- Allow to c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y your delicious garlic butter mushroom and mozzarella calzones!
The history of the Mushroom and Mozzarella Calzone with a garlic butter crust can be traced back to the beautiful region of Campania, Italy. This delectable dish has been a staple in Italian cuisine for centuries, with its origins rooted in the traditional calzone, a folded pizza filled with various ingredients. The addition of mushrooms and mozzarella, combined with a flavorful garlic butter crust, adds a modern twist to this classic dish. Renowned chefs in Naples, the birthplace of pizza, have perfected the art of creating the perfect calzone, and their expertise has influenced variations of the dish worldwide. Today, the best versions of this calzone can be found in authentic Italian pizzerias that prioritize using fresh, high-quality ingredients. The key to achieving the perfect Mushroom and Mozzarella Calzone lies in the balance of flavors and textures, from the earthy mushrooms to the creamy mozzarella, all encased in a golden, buttery crust infused with aromatic garlic. For those looking to recreate this dish at home, mastering the technique of creating a light and airy pizza dough is essential. The garlic butter crust should be brushed generously over the calzone before baking, imparting a rich and savory flavor to the finished product. Whether enjoyed in a cozy trattoria in Naples or crafted with love in a home kitchen, the Mushroom and Mozzarella Calzone with a garlic butter crust is a delightful marriage of traditional and contemporary Italian flavors.
